Transaction 8598140686327f509241e1ac130c3ed1f898c32d19bdb02ccc6a508864a917be

2 Input
2 Outputs
  • 8598140686327f509241e1ac130c3ed1f898c32d19bdb02ccc6a508864a917be:0
  • value  5209
    address  1Nmaws1ZWemoQv3SbsMpCn5gAxGXnjAnJ1
  • 8598140686327f509241e1ac130c3ed1f898c32d19bdb02ccc6a508864a917be:1
  • value  7895900
    address  1P2vn9iYink9kHzuHJveTABJRfEGJ1GiZ8